ABSTRACT:
Olefins such as ethylene can be polymerized in high productivities using a catalyst system wherein one catalyst component comprises a precipitated complex of zirconium tetrahydrocarbyloxide and/or titanium tetrahydrocarbyloxide and dihydrocarbylmagnesium. The productivity of the preferred catalyst containing both zirconium and titanium has been found to be substantially higher than the productivity of those catalysts obtained from either only Zr(OR').sub.4 or only Ti(OR").sub.4 and second catalyst component comprises at least one organometallic compound of a metal selected from the Groups I-III of the Mendeleev Periodic Table.
